Transaction 876529073c643bc9cf4897ebfd0c6b53d549a4e56a81300020be273a3e856a61
1 Input
1 Output
-
876529073c643bc9cf4897ebfd0c6b53d549a4e56a81300020be273a3e856a61:0
- value
- 186017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14bdb73f7fcf9938ffbd68e7b5a9a2772653de28 OP_EQUAL
- address
- 33agi4nfuAqHNLGxL9GHoZQBMAhkkUAsnp